Summary: | PROBLEM TO BE SOLVED: To enable sharing of an RS-232C cable to be employed when connecting a data terminal device and a line terminator device and when connecting data terminal devices respectively. SOLUTION: An RS-232C cable is constituted of cables 3 and 4, connectors CN1 and CN2, provided one ends of the cables 3 and 4 and connected to a data terminal device DTE, a connector CN3 provided at the other end of the cable 3, and a connector CN4 normally connected and reversely connected to the connector CN3, the connectors 3 and 4 are provided with odd numbers of terminals containing an SG terminal arranged at the center thereof, plural groups of terminals for transmission and reception control are arranged at a position symmetrical against the SG terminal, and a dummy terminal 6 is provided on one side of the SG terminal, and two control terminals 3 and 4, commonly connected when reverse connection is made, are provided on the other side thereof. |
